If you’re looking out to keep your power consumption low, then stay away from the Dreamscene function built within Vista Ultimate. It looks really cool, and yeah, I love the eye candy, but it may not be worth it.

One of the visual improvements about Vista is ‘Dreamscene.’ This is a feature only included in the Ultimate version, but can be hacked into the other versions. Microsoft’s Vista is now one year old, and what a year it has been. While the operating system had quite the rocky start with 3rd party drivers and hardware support, it seems that a good majority of the bugs have been worked out.
